   First report of Cryptosporidium canis in farmed Arctic foxes (Vulpes lagopus) in China

چکیده    Background: cryptosporidium is an important genus of enteric zoonotic parasites,which can infect a wide range of animals including foxes. little information is available concerning the prevalence and molecular characterisation of cryptosporidium spp. in farmed arctic foxes (vulpes lagopus) in china. thus,the objective of the present study was to investigate the prevalence of cryptosporidium spp. in arctic foxes in china using nested pcr amplification of the small subunit ribosomal rna (ssu rrna) gene. findings: the overall prevalence of cryptosporidium spp. in arctic foxes was 15.9 % (48/302),with 12.9 % in male (18/139) and 18.4 % in female (30/163) foxes,respectively. the prevalence in different farms varied from 0 to 31.43 %. the prevalence of infection in different age groups varied from 14.1 % to 19.0 %. foxes from hebei province (7.8 %,11/141) had a significantly lower cryptosporidium spp. prevalence than those from heilongjiang province (22.9 %,16/70) and jilin province (23.1 %,21/91) (p= 0.0015). sequence analysis of the ssu rrna gene indicated that all the 48 isolates represented c. canis. conclusions: this is the first report of c. canis infection in farmed arctic foxes in china,which also provides foundation data for preventing and controlling cryptosporidium infection in foxes,other animals and humans. © 2016 zhang et al.
